A silver-mounted cut glass scent bottle and five various toilet bottles
the scent bottle maker's mark of Walker and Hall, Sheffield, 1901,
The sides pierced with scrolls, quatrefoils and chased with floral swags and winged putti the domed cover inset with tortoiseshell with blue glasss liner and an oval facetted glass toilet jar with silver cover, London, 1891 and a tapering cylindrical cut glass scent bottle with facetted glass stopper, London, 1922; a cylindrical cut glass toilet jar with slightly domed cover and stud finial, engraved with initial A G G, Birmingham, 1913; a small cylindrical glass toilet jar with hobnail cut body the domed cover engraved initials E F, Birmingham, 1900 and an hexagonal glass toilet jar with slightly domed cover with beaded border engraved with initials M H M, by Goreham,
3¾in. (9.5cm.) high and smaller (6)
